Daze
[n] confusion characterized by lack of clarity
[n] the feeling of distress and disbelief that you have when something bad happens accidentally; "his mother's deathleft him in a daze"; "he was numb with shock"
[v] overcome esp. with astonishment or disbelief; "The news stunned her"
[v] to cause someone to lose clear vision, esp. from intense light; "She was dazzled by the bright headlights"
